Clash 教程:从安装到配置的详细指南

什么是 Clash?

Clash 是一个支持多种协议的代理工具,其具有高度可配置性、灵活的规则和完善的 UI,适用于科学上网等多种场景。其最受欢迎的版本是 Clash for Windows 和 Clash for Android,这使得用户可以在多个平台上方便地进行代理设置。

Clash 的核心功能

  • 多种协议支持:支持 Shadowsocks、VMess、Trojan 等多种流行协议。
  • 精确的规则配置:用户能够通过配置文件来定义哪些流量使用代理。
  • 负载均衡:可以轻松地设置负载均衡策略,提升网络速率。
  • 快速的节点切换:支持一键切换代理节点,提高上网的体验。

Clash 安装教程

1. 下载 Clash

您可以通过以下步骤下载 Clash:

  • 访问 Clash 的 GitHub 页面(https://github.com/Dreamacro/clash/releases)。
  • 根据您的操作系统选择不同的安装包进行下载。

2. 安装 Clash

对于 Windows 用户:

  • 解压下载好的文件。
  • 点击 clash.exe 文件运行应用程序。

对于 macOS 用户:

  • 将 Clash 应用拖拽至应用程序文件夹。
  • 通过终端打开 Clash。

对于 Linux 用户:

  • 使用命令行进行下载并给予运行权限,例如:
    bash
    wget https://github.com/Dreamacro/clash/releases/download/…/clash-linux-amd64
    chmod +x clash-linux-amd64
    ./clash-linux-amd64

3. 整理配置文件

Clash 的配置文件格式为 YAML,用户可自定义该文件以决定使用哪些节点和规则。

Clash 配置教程

1. 创建并编辑配置文件

配置文件默认通常放置在 ~/.config/clash/ 目录下。创建一个 config.yaml 文件,打开并编辑该文件,例如:
yaml
port: 7890
proxy-groups:

  • name: PROXY
    type: select
    proxies:
    • node1
    • node2

hosts:

  • ‘*.example.com: 127.0.0.1’

  • proxies 部分定义代理节点。

2. 启动 Clash

在已经配置好 config.yaml 文件后,通过以下命令启动 Clash:

./clash -f ~/.config/clash/config.yaml

3. 验证配置

使用网络代理工具(如浏览器插件),将系统代理设置指向 Clash 服务端口(默认为 7890)。访问被阻止的网站以验证配置是否成功。

Clash 使用技巧

  • 智能路由:利用规则性配置,让用户可以设置哪些流量走代理或者直连。
  • 节点测速:定期测试节点的连接速度,选择最优节点使用。
  • 定期更新配置:确保配置文件中的节点信息是最新的。

常见问题

如何确保 Clash 一直在运行?

您可以使用第三方服务通过脚本或定时任务保持 müəyyən时段运行 Clash 应用。

Clash 是否可以同时支持多个设备?

Clash 本身作为一个代理工具,可以与多个设备相连,只需相关网络设置详细配置。

如何快速添加节点?

您可以前往各大节点提供商网站,复制节点信息,然后粘贴至您的配置文件中。

为什么我的 Clash 无法上网?

检查您的配置文件,确保文件格式正确且代理地址和端口设置无误。此外,确保网络连接稳定。

结语

以上就是关于 Clash 的详细使用和配置教程。希望这篇教程能帮助您更好地掌握 Clash 应用,提高网络的使用效率!如果您有任何疑问,请不吝留下您宝贵的意见。

正文完
 0